Performance in Real-Life Embroidery Situations
When it comes to real-life embroidery, the Christmas Bear and Reindeer Caroling design performs well. The clean lines and simple shapes make it suitable for a variety of fabrics, from smooth cotton to slightly textured materials. However, it's important to test the design on scrap fabric first to ensure that the stitch density and thread colors work well together. For instance, using a satin stitch for the outlines and a fill stitch for the larger areas can help maintain the design's clarity and visual appeal.
Where to Use Carefully
- Small Hoop Sizes: The design may not fit well in very small hoops, so check the hoop size before starting your project.
- Textured Fabrics: While the design works on slightly textured fabrics, avoid using it on highly textured or stretchy materials, as this can distort the image.
- Dark Fabric: The black and white line art style might not stand out as well on dark backgrounds, so consider using a lighter fabric or adding a light-colored underlay.
- Curved Surfaces: For curved surfaces like caps, the design may need some adjustments to fit properly, especially around the corners and edges.

Practical Embroidery Designer Notes
- Test on Scrap Fabric: Always start by testing the design on scrap fabric to ensure it meets your expectations.
- Check Thread Color Contrast: Make sure the thread colors provide good contrast, especially if you're using a dark fabric.
- Review Stitch Density: Adjust the stitch density if needed to prevent the design from looking too dense or too loose.
- Confirm Hoop Size: Ensure the design fits within the hoop size you plan to use.
- Inspect Small Details: Pay close attention to small details, such as the musical notes and candle flames, to ensure they are clear and well-defined.
- Test in Black and White Mockups: Create black and white mockups to see how the design will look without color, which can be useful for certain projects.
- Compare Light and Dark Fabric Backgrounds: Test the design on both light and dark fabrics to see which background works best.
- Use Proper Stabilizer: Choose the right stabilizer for your fabric to ensure the design stitches cleanly and stays in place.
- Check Licensing Terms: Before using the design for commercial projects, confirm the licensing terms to ensure you have the right to sell finished items or digital products.
